This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] TPS3852:Set1输入性能

Guru**** 2463330 points
Other Parts Discussed in Thread: TPS3852, TMS570LS0232, TPS3890

请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/power-management-group/power-management/f/power-management-forum/566434/tps3852-set1-input-performance

器件型号:TPS3852
主题中讨论的其他器件: TMS570LS0232TPS3890

我需要稍微澄清一下 TPS3852的数据表。

当我们遇到看门狗故障时、这将在 TMS570LS0232上启动 PORRST 事件、因为我的 WDO 输出是线性的或连接到连接到微控制器上电复位引脚的1.25V 监控器 IC 的输出。

数据表的图20显示了 SET1输入连接到 TPS3890的典型应用、TPS3890可生成长输入脉冲、从而在复位恢复/上电初始化期间禁用看门狗计时器。 此电路在初始化启动时会很好、但当您有看门狗引起的复位时、该概念会失败、因为您在第二个初始化周期中不再有禁用的看门狗。

一种可能的解决方法是将看门狗引起的复位反馈到 TPS3890的/MR 输入引脚。  这将通过清除 SET1输入低电平来禁用看门狗、从而重复初始上电复位看门狗事件。

我的问题是、如果 SET1在200ms 标称 WDO 低电平脉冲周期内清零、WDO 输出会怎样?  WDO 输出是否立即变为高阻抗、或者在\WDO 引脚进入 SET1低电平请求的高阻抗状态之前、tRST 延迟是否完成?

或者、我是否需要改用 nRST 热复位、并启动看门狗恢复代码、该代码会在看门狗复位结束后立即为其提供服务?

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    此外、数据表规定:
    "7.3.4.5看门狗输出 WDO
    TPS3852具有一个具有独立看门狗输出(WDO)的窗口看门狗。 独立
    看门狗输出可在看门狗计时出现故障时灵活地进行标记、而无需执行
    整个系统复位。 对于传统应用、可以将 WDO 绑定到复位。 而复位输出不是
    确认 WDO 信号将保持正常运行。 然而、当复位信号被置为有效时、WDO
    引脚将进入高阻抗状态。 这是由于在发生故障时使用标准复位时序选项
    发生在 WDO 上。 一旦复位被取消置位、窗口看门狗定时器将恢复正常运行。'

    这是否仅适用于器件发出的复位、或者如果另一个系统在 WDO 输出端发出复位事件(例如、如果我将/WDO 输出绑定到 nRST 并且 nRST 被内部系统中断拉低)、也是如此?
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好、Jeffery、

    如果 SET1被拉至低电平、禁用部件/WDO 将变为高阻抗并将变为逻辑高电平。 如果 SET1引脚保持低电平的时间不超过 trst、/WDO 将保持高电平、直到 trst 完成。 如果不需要此行为、则强制执行/RESET (强制 VDD 低于 VIT-)以清除此情况。

    第7.3.4.5节看门狗输出/WDO 仅讨论 TPS3852发出的/RESET 和/WDO 事件。 如果外部器件发出/reset、/WDO 和/reset 将保持正常运行。 如果 TPS3852发出/reset、/WDO 将变为高阻抗、直到 trst 过期。

    请告诉我、您是否需要任何其他资源。

    此致、

    标记

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好、Mark。  

    我很抱歉、但我仍需要对该部件对 SET1输入的状态变化的反应进行一点澄清。

    请确认此解释正确。

    1. 如果在触发 WDO 复位事件之前将 SET1拉为低电平、则
      1. 看门狗功能立即禁用
      2. WDO 变为高阻抗、然后
      3. 在状态机复位之前、WWDT 将被禁用、SET1恢复为高电平150us。
    2. 如果在 WDO 复位事件期间将 SET1拉至低电平
      1. 完整的 WDO 低电平脉冲(时间= trst、标称值为200ms)将在 WDO 变为高阻抗之前完成。  
      2. 当 trst 输出脉冲到期时、
        1. 看门狗功能被禁用、
        2. WDO 变为高阻抗、然后
        3. 在状态机复位之前、WWDT 将被禁用、SET1恢复为高电平150us。

    谢谢

    Jeff

     

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Jeff:

    我对我在最后一个回复中产生的任何困惑都进行了拓扑。 我附上了一份范围捕获文件,该文件应有助于澄清这一点。 此范围捕获显示 了在发生复位事件期间禁用 WWDT 时发生的情况。

    我在下面准备了您的帖子、以便我可以逐一回答您的问题。

    [引用用户="Jeffrey Cranmer "]

    您好、Mark。  

    我很抱歉、但我仍需要对该部件对 SET1输入的状态变化的反应进行一点澄清。

    请确认此解释正确。

    1. 如果在触发 WDO 复位事件之前将 SET1拉为低电平、则
      1. 看门狗功能立即禁用
        1. 是的、如果 SET1在 WDO 复位事件之前被拉至低电平、则这是正确的。看门狗功能被禁用、WDI 的输入被忽略。
      2. WDO 变为高阻抗、然后
        1. 是的、WDO 将是高阻抗、上拉电阻器应尝试将其变为高电平。
      3. 在状态机复位之前、WWDT 将被禁用、SET1恢复为高电平150us。
        1. 如果在 WDO 复位事件之前将 SET1拉为低电平、它将在 SET1恢复高电平后的150us 之前被禁用。 除非复位线路上有另一个故障、否则这将导致 WDO 保持高阻抗、直到该故障也被清除。
    2. 如果在 WDO 复位事件期间将 SET1拉至低电平
      1. 完整的 WDO 低电平脉冲(时间= trst、标称值为200ms)将在 WDO 变为高阻抗之前完成。
        1. 不禁用看门狗定时器将导致 WDO 变为高阻抗。 请参阅随附的示波器屏幕截图。 Set1为粉色、WDO 为蓝色、复位为黄色。
      2. 当 trst 输出脉冲到期时、
        1. 看门狗功能被禁用、
          1. 一旦 SET1被拉至低电平、看门狗装置就会被禁用。
        2. WDO 变为高阻抗、然后
          1. 一旦 SET1为逻辑低电平、WDO 就会变为高阻抗。
        3. 在状态机复位之前、WWDT 将被禁用、SET1恢复为高电平150us。
          1. 在 SET1返回高电平之前、将禁用正确的 WWDT。 在我所连接的示波器快照中、您可以看到、当 SET1返回高电平时、WDO 保持高电平~63ms (twdu)、这是因为 WWDT 没有 WDI 信号输入。 因此、当超过上限时、WDO 将被拉低200ms。

    谢谢

    Jeff

    此致、
    标记

     

    [/报价]